Web21 jun. 2024 · The most common translation is 'you're welcome': prego is what you say when someone else thanks you. – Grazie mille! – Prego. – Thanks very much! – You're welcome. Similarly, it can means 'that's quite alright' – whether someone's thanking you for something that's no big deal or asking your forgiveness. – Mi scuso per il ritardo. – Prego. Web7 jan. 2024 · cgrayce. "La" is the direct object pronoun for "you" when speaking formally. "Prego" is the first person singular form of "pregare" (to beg, beseech, pray), so the literal translation is "I beg you (formal) to enter." You could render it that way in English but it would be archaic. The modern translation is "please enter."

Web19 feb. 2024 · Ti ringrazio tanto – “Thank you very much”. Ti ringrazio tanto is another expression to say “Thank you very much” in Italian. It is a synonym of Grazie tante but a little bit more emphatic. In fact, the literal translation would be “I thank you a lot” and puts emphasis on the fact that I am thanking you significantly. Webprego [ˈprɛɡo ] exclamation (a chi ringrazia) don’t mention it! ⧫ you’re welcome! ⧫ not at all! (invitando qn ad accomodarsi) please sit down! (invitando qn ad andare prima) after you! prego, si accomodi (entri) please come in; (si sieda) please take a seat posso prenderlo? — prego! can I take it? — please do! prego? pardon? ⧫ sorry? Web15 mei 2024 · “ Prego ” can also mean please in Italian. As stated, you would express agreement by uttering “ Sì, grazie .” But sometimes, you may want to say “ Prego .” To clarify, “ prego ” has another meaning, which is similar to the English phrase “I insist.”
